GIS Next Generation 9-1-1 GIS: Getting Started With the advent of NG9-1-1 call routing and location technologies dependent on local GIS data, even more responsibility for timely and accurate spatial data will fall upon local governments. This interactive session and case study examines the processes and local accountability that will be required in the future and participants will discuss developing methodologies and processes for reporting and improving the accuracy of the GIS data, street centerline, and MSAG synchronicity. NG9-1-1 & EMERGENCY SERVICES Operational Continuity When All Else Fails Readiness lies at the heart of public safety. This session discusses key factors to consider when preparing for times when systems are compromised or over-taxed, and emergency communications imperiled. Attendees will learn how a viable plan can provide for operational continuity in the event of natural or man-made disasters or other emergency incidents. LEADERSHIP & MANAGEMENT Dealing with Change in the Communications Center In the constantly evolving public safety landscape, we need to learn how to better manage change within our organizations and understand how it affects us personally and professionally. Each of us play a role in how successful we are in adapting to that change whether it is technological, cultural, or administrative in nature. Come to this discussion and learn what you can do to prepare yourself and your staff for the road ahead.
